ICD-10-CM Code T41.20
Poisoning by, adverse effect of and underdosing of unspecified general anesthetics

NON-BILLABLE
Non-Billable Code
Non-Billable means the code is not sufficient justification for admission to an acute care hospital when used a principal diagnosis. Use a child code to capture more detail.
| ICD-10 from 2011 - 2016

ICD Code T41.20 is a non-billable code. To code a diagnosis of this type, you must use one of the six child codes of T41.20 that describes the diagnosis 'unsp general anesthetics' in more detail.
